Default transmission problem (help with diagnostic) '91

My 1991 ls400 has started acting up recently. At full throttle the car downshifts for only a split second, than slips back into a higher gear. Under hard acceleration the transmission only kicksdown when it wants to. Under normal driving the tranmission generally shifts smooth, but has the occational hard shift. I just drained and filled that transmission fluid, and there where no metal shavings in the fluid and the fluid was not black. The magnetic drain plug had no metal shavings on it either. The engine runs fine (as well as it can with 250,000 miles on it), but I think it might be the TPS. Any input would be greatly appreciated. I have searched the forum and was unable to find a similar problem to mine.
